BAM Graffiti Hightech Oblong Violin Case (Green & Orange)

The BAM Graffiti Hightech Oblong Violin Case is a professional-grade instrument protector designed for travelling musicians, featuring a distinctive green and orange aesthetic. It utilizes a proprietary multi-layer shell construction to provide high-level security while remaining exceptionally lightweight at 2.57 kg.

Overview

The BAM Graffiti Hightech Oblong Violin Case is a premium storage solution situated within BAM's high-performance range. Known for balancing structural integrity with aesthetic flair, this specific model features a bold green and orange 'Graffiti' finish. It is engineered specifically for the 4/4 violin, offering a tailored fit that prioritises instrument immobilisation and thermal protection. The oblong shape provides additional internal space for accessories compared to kontour or slim models.

Construction and Technology

Central to the case's performance is the Bam Hightech technique. This triple-ply structure consists of:

  • ABS Exterior: A rigid outer layer to resist impact.
  • Solid Polyurethane Foam: An injected core that provides structural rigidity and thermal insulation.
  • PETG Layer: A final internal layer that contributes to the overall durability of the shell.

This combination ensures that the case remains extremely rigid without the heavy weight associated with traditional wooden or fibreglass cases.

Ergonomics and Portability

Designed for the pragmatic musician, the case includes several features to facilitate easy transport. It weighs only 2.57 kg, making it suitable for long-distance travel and frequent commuting. Users benefit from neoprene anti-slip backpack straps, which distribute weight evenly across the shoulders. For hand-carrying, the case is equipped with a bi-material side handle, providing a comfortable grip that reduces hand fatigue. Furthermore, the integrated back cushion doubles as a music pouch, allowing players to store sheet music directly on the case.

Security Features

Instrument safety is handled through both physical protection and theft deterrence. The case is fitted with two combination locks, removing the need for physical keys that can be lost. The airtight seal created when the case is closed helps protect the violin from sudden changes in humidity and temperature, which are critical factors for preserving stringed instruments.

Comparison to Alternatives

Within the BAM catalogue, the Graffiti Hightech sits alongside models like the Artisto Oblong (often found in Red) and the Conservatoire 4/4. While the Artisto offers a more traditional aesthetic, the Graffiti model utilizes the superior Hightech shell construction for better weight-to-strength ratios. Compared to the L'Etoile Slim Cello cases or the New Trekking trumpet cases, the Graffiti Oblong Violin case is specifically optimized for the dimensions and fragility of a full-sized violin.
